Empire Exhibition was held in Glasgow from May to December 1938.
The United Kingdom Alliance (UKA) was a British temperance organisation. It was founded in 1853 in Manchester to work for the prohibition of the trade in alcohol in the United Kingdom.
Made by H.W. Miller
Size is 42mm x 23.7mm.
